Output 71520495a62163e53595a75c80fb52640fc1d5e6f798da9d60272b375a58c429:1

value
41640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688f1f2a53cea274323ee8b67481a1b469199e25 OP_EQUAL
address
3BDsemSB5rKw426tiJM1hia8BG4MaUQyKX
transaction
71520495a62163e53595a75c80fb52640fc1d5e6f798da9d60272b375a58c429
spent
true